[float=left][attach=1][/float] At long last, Crysis 2 players on the pc side of things can rejoice! Crytek will be releasing the 1.9 patch on June 27th, containing a "high resolution pack" and game support for directX11. Crytek's CEO calls the improvement a "sneak peak of how PC gaming will evolve in the future." No word on how much the boost will effect performance but if it is anything like the lower settings, the game should still be more optimized than its predecessor and run smoother.
